Porphobilinogen was isolated by Westall (1952) from the urine of a patient with acute porphyria. A structure (I), to be discussed later, was assigned to it by Cookson & Rimington (1953) and Cookson (1953a) on the basis of the chemical reactions briefly recorded in these preliminary notes, and was further supported by the X-ray crystallographic investigations of Kennard (1953). In the present paper our chemical studies are described in detail, together with an improved method of isolation of porphobilinogen, and a discussion of its conversion into porphyrin.
